About Team:
Walmart Master Data Management team is building Next Generation data orchestration systems that enables master data ingestion across different engineering modules across supply chain. Our team is growing, and we are looking for a highly motivated Senior Software Engineer who will be playing a crucial role in design and implementation high performing systems and integrations which are production ready to deliver key insights to the Walmart supply chain and order management systems.


What you'll do:

  • Demonstrates up-to-date expertise and applies this to the development, execution, and improvement of action plans.
  • Leads the discovery phase of medium to large projects to come up with high level design.
  • Models compliance with company policies and procedures and supports company mission, values, and standards of ethics and integrity.
  • Provides and supports the implementation of business solutions.
  • Provides support to the business.
  • Troubleshoots business and production issues.
  • Work with application engineers and data scientists to define the requirements for the data products that the team creates
  • Develop and maintain data schemas and dictionaries; defines metadata
  • Build data system and data quality monitoring process and ensure health of the big data system
  • Debug and maintain data pipelines
  • Develop data APIs to support analytics and data science products


What you'll bring:.

  • Experience with Google Cloud Platform, especially Data-Proc and Google Cloud Storage
  • Experience with the Scala ,Spark ecosystem
  • Experience with the Java, Spring, Kafka ecosystem
  • Experience with Apache Airflow
  • Relational and/or NoSQL Database experience
  • Strong ability in problem solving
  • Worked on monitoring and alerting tools - Experience with configuring or implementing Build & Deployment (CI/CD) pipeline and infrastructure as a service.

At Walmart, we offer competitive pay as well as performance-based bonus awards and other great benefits for a happier mind, body, and wallet. Health benefits include medical, vision and dental coverage. Financial benefits include 401(k), stock purchase and company-paid life insurance. Paid time off benefits include PTO (including sick leave), parental leave, family care leave, bereavement, jury duty, and voting. Other benefits include short-term and long-term disability, company discounts, Military Leave Pay, adoption and surrogacy expense reimbursement, and more.

Live Better U is a Walmart-paid education benefit program for full-time and part-time associates in Walmart and Sam's Club facilities.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or's deg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are completely paid for by Walmart.
